In this episode, we break down several major developments shaping the gaming industry right now. We start with the legal battle between Valve and the New York Attorney General over whether loot boxes in games like Counter‑Strike 2 qualify as gambling or simply function like collectible trading cards. Next, we explore how Outersloth—the funding arm of the studio behind Among Us—is shaking up indie development by publicly sharing its funding contract and revenue-share model in an effort to promote transparency. We also discuss a potential industry shake-up as Paramount may acquire Warner Bros. Games, potentially gaining control of major studios behind franchises like Hogwarts Legacy and Mortal Kombat. Finally, we look at new platform changes from Microsoft, including the upcoming “Xbox Mode” for Windows 11, designed to bring a more console-like gaming experience to PC players.
